ARKADELPHIA, Ark. — Even though the ESPN show ‘College Gameday’ didn’t come to Arkadelphia after much anticipation, that didn’t dull fans’ enthusiasm for the 98th Battle of the Ravine.
The game is unusual regardless of whether any major networks show up; for instance, it’s not often you see the road team walking to a college football game with their fans lining the streets.
“It’s different from every game you have throughout the year,” Cody Aderholt, a senior at Ouachita Baptist University (OBU), said.
The main reason the rivalry between OBU and the Henderson State Reddies is so special?
The two schools’ stadiums are just a five-minute walk.
